What is a personal branding?

A personal brand is how you present yourself as a content creator. It includes your name, personality, and the things that make you who you are. People are interested in your content and want to see more, and your brand is what makes you stand out.

Know the people you want to reach

Social media is beneficial because it lets you connect directly with the people you want to reach. No longer do businesses have to fill out lengthy questionnaires for market research to find out more about the people they want to sell to. Right now, everything you need to know about what your fans want is how they react to your posts. You posted something, and ten people liked it. The following week, you posted something else, and 200 people liked it. Of course, because you got their attention and they want more of what you have to offer. Furthermore, even though nobody wants terrible reviews, they sometimes turn out to be helpful. You can make the changes you need to in order to give your audience what they wish after reading a bad review.

Talk to your followers

Only some fans will turn into customers, and you have to learn that it's okay. However, talking to them is essential for building your brand because people want to know that there is a natural person behind the business. Responding to comments on social media and writing thank-you notes to customers who leave good reviews are easy ways to interact with others.


Be always the same

Finally, always do the same thing. Using a program like Adobe Express can make it easier to create content over time. It will be some time before you find a good theme. There will be a lot of trying and failing, but when you get it right, wait don't change it until your gut tells you to. People will get used to your brand and be able to spot it whenever they see it. When you do decide to change the theme, include your audience in the process of coming up with the new theme. For example, if you want to change your logo, have a few different copies made and let them choose the best one.
